Nice one. When my group was in training (deep in the jungles of upper west side Manhattan) they had a policy of not telling us where we were going to be posted until we actually arrived in Ghana. The thought-masters thought (rightly) that if any one of us found out where we were going to be posted that s/he would bail out. (If I knew I was going to be posted to Accra I'm very certain I would not have gone.) However, the simile among us trainees was that Navrongo was the absolute end of the line. Navrongo-as-Purgatory-on-Earth. You couldn't do worse than that. Little did we know! That wise old thought-meister was Gene Ashby who, I'm certain, went on to greater things. He was the director of training for our group in the green pastures of Columbia University. The year was 1966. The Peace Corps of the 1960s was probably considerably different from what I imagine it to be nowadays. We did three months as pcTs----"Don't sell your house or car yet, you're *only* peace corps Trainees." "What house?" we said, "and anyway the bank owns the car." "De-selection" was the dirtiest word in our vocabulary. Worse even than "Navrongo". We knew that attrition rates during training could be very high. Sometimes as high as 75%. We learned excellent team skills during training---protecting the vulnerable, ganging up on the thought-masters, etc. (There are some very long stories enshrouded in that one tiny "etc".) We started with about 75 and only lost three involuntarily. Come to think of it, that was a stunning achievement. We were given wide-ranging psych tests. I'm certain they were searching out those of us who might have had a closet penchant for young boys. We owe a hell of a debt to Gene Ashby, and to Jim Marvin. Jim was a fellow pcT. One of the shrink tests they gave us was called the MMPI, a very long multiple choice affair. Prior to us taking the test Jim gave us all a little private tuition: never lie (because there are hidden questions that check for consistency of response), but never ever admit to stomach trouble of any kind. We all came out with nice flat graphs: we were normal! Uh-huh. The thought-meisters never twigged that Jim had gone to the University of Minnesota and that he had had a vacation job grading other people's Minnesota Multi-Phasic Personality Inventories=MMPI. To this day I have never ever admitted to any stomach trouble. Look where it's gotten me! Thanks, Jim. They didn't tell us where we were going to be posted until we arrived in Accra. Gary Johnson drew the Navrongo short straw and we all commiserated with him. But somebody (I think it was Jan Ems) got posted to Lawra. "Jesus, where's that? Oh shit, you have to go to Navrongo first just to get to Lawra." Is my geography right? Gets a bit hazy after 30 years. But Larry Wolfson and Gayle Weller actually got sent to Bawku. When I saw Gayle after he had been in Bawku for a year he told me that his predecessor told him he was standing by the window of his classroom one day and a guy stumbled out of the bush onto the school soccer field with an arrow sticking out of his back! I expect these days that even the wars fought for territory in isolated places like northern Ghana use heavy weaponry. I was disgusted to discover recently that the biggest arms dealing country is not Switzerland but the United States. I've lived in New Zealand for over 25 years and it's times like this that I do not regret moving here. I came to love the north. I spent all my school vacations (I was a teacher in a tiny village in Brong Ahafo called Acherensua) in Burkina Faso aka Upper Volta, Niger and Mali. I would go back in a flash (but never to Accra), and am intending to do so when I retire. What's the current Peace Corps policy on recruiting older volunteers?
Thanks for the reveries.

I was a British contract teacher (chemistry) at Navasco 1967-1971, so the Navrongo pages brought back many happy memories. I recall a number of PCVs at Navasco while I was there - John Miazga (of Pueblo, Colorado) - a great biology teacher, Harry Malakoff (of NY), Eli (?, of Boston) & a number of others - they were great people. I remember bringing sacks of sugar & dried yeast back from the south in my Land Rover for Kwesi, my cook, to make akpeteshie (spelling?) in his compound. Also remember a very fine young man Stanislaus Kaditi, who I believe later trained to be a teacher. Ah, those were the days - when there were plenty of crates of Club & Star to stack into the kerosene-run fridges, & we would sit on the verandah of the bungalow of an evening watching an approaching storm, smelling the rain before it fell, and the mad rush to close the windows when the storm finally broke.
